Git的简单使用
第一次开发先在线上创建一个码云仓库,在新建一个分支。然后在电脑上选取一个文件夹,比如桌面,然后把线上仓库的代码克隆到本地,自动创建了一个项目文件夹
git clone git@gitee.com:xxx/xxx.git
git clone后面的是码云上复制的代码地址
1.首先打开码云(git),创建一个分支,比如说city-search
2.进入终端运行
git pull
3.然后切换到city-search分支上进行开发
git checkout city-search
4.启动本地项目
npm run dev
5.进入浏览器,打开localhost:8081
6.进行开发...
7.开发完毕把所有代码提交本地暂存区
git add .
8.将暂存区里的改动给提交到本地的版本库 //引号中为提示信息
git commit -m‘add search to city’
9.提交到线上的对应分支上
git push
10.别忘了切换到主分支上
git checkout master
11.让主分支和最新的代码合并
git merge city-search
12.再把主分支提交到线上
git push
Git常用操作
一.下载码云历史版本代码
1.git clone不指定分支
git clone http://10.1.1.11/service/tmall-service.git
2.git clone指定分支
git clone -b dev_jk git@gitee.com:xxx/xxx.git
后面的url是从码云上历史版本复制
二.当前的目录不是一个git仓库
在添加远程库的时候报错
fatal: Not a git repository(or any of the parent directories): .git
当前的目录不是一个git仓库
解决的办法有两种:
1.初始化一个本地仓库git init
2.进入到本地仓库目录windows用cd path
三.新建分支操作
1.创建本地分支
git branch report
2.切换到本地分支
git checkout report
前两步等于
git checkout -b report
3.创建远程分支
git push origin report
4.本地分支与远程分支关联??
git push —set-upstream origin report
—代表两个-,第四步不确定对不对
五.查看分支状态
git branch
六.查看修改内容
git status
ps:如果提交时显示一段信息(输入提交消息来解释为什么这种合并是必要的),两种解决方式:
第一:
1.按键盘字母i进入insert模式
2.修改最上面那行黄色合并信息
第二:
1.按键盘左上角"Esc"
2.输入冒号加wq ":wq", 按回车键,意思就是就是忽略这个提示